Output 3b20afa895510fd1ae80f996eadac14514a957cd5f423455d4da8787dfb15256:8

value
21405240
script pubkey
OP_0 OP_PUSHBYTES_20 581efe4609dda6e3efaf7526e99e77465ec7553d
address
ltc1qtq00u3sfmknw8ma0w5nwn8nhge0vw4faytl7re
transaction
3b20afa895510fd1ae80f996eadac14514a957cd5f423455d4da8787dfb15256
spent
true